I just got this motherboard (Biostar TForce 965PT), and am having difficulties installing the stock Intel cooler. Is it normal for this board to be flexing a little bit towards the top? All of the push pins of the Intel cooler are pushed down as far as they can go. As far I can tell the HSF is installed properly. Is this normal and can I operate the computer like this, or should I get another HSF with a proper backplate?

The board should be flexed from all four heatsink push pins and forming a slight outward bulge in the bottom of the board directly under where the heatsink is located. The flexing is normal and should not affect the board. The foxconn 775 board I used in a build a couple of years ago is still running fine and it was flexing too when I installed it.
